Hormones play a pivotal role in regulating the female reproductive system. Any disruption in the hormonal balance can lead to infertility. The most common hormonal disorders affecting fertility include polycystic ovary syndrome (PCOS), thyroid dysfunction, and hyperprolactinemia.
Polycystic Ovary Syndrome (PCOS)
PCOS is a condition characterized by the presence of multiple cysts on the ovaries and is often accompanied by irregular menstrual cycles, excess androgen levels, and insulin resistance. These hormonal imbalances can interfere with ovulation, making it difficult for women to conceive.
Thyroid Dysfunction
Both hypothyroidism and hyperthyroidism can adversely affect fertility. Hypothyroidism, or an underactive thyroid, can disrupt menstrual cycles and ovulation, while hyperthyroidism, or an overactive thyroid, can lead to irregular periods and miscarriage.
Hyperprolactinemia
Elevated levels of prolactin, a hormone responsible for milk production, can inhibit ovulation and cause infertility. This condition may result from pituitary gland disorders, medications, or other underlying health issues.
Lifestyle Factors Affecting Female Fertility
Lifestyle choices and environmental factors can significantly impact female fertility. Factors such as diet, exercise, stress, and exposure to toxins play a crucial role in reproductive health.
Diet and Nutrition
A balanced diet rich in essential nutrients is vital for maintaining hormonal balance and overall reproductive health. Deficiencies in vitamins and minerals, such as folic acid, iron, and vitamin D, can impair fertility. Additionally, excessive consumption of caffeine and alcohol can negatively affect fertility.
Exercise and Body Weight
Both excessive exercise and sedentary lifestyles can lead to fertility issues. Maintaining a healthy body weight is essential, as being underweight or overweight can disrupt hormonal balance and ovulation. Women with a body mass index (BMI) outside the normal range are more likely to experience fertility problems.
Stress
Chronic stress can lead to hormonal imbalances that affect ovulation and menstrual cycles. High levels of stress can also impact overall health, making it more challenging for women to conceive.
Environmental Toxins
Exposure to environmental toxins, such as pesticides, heavy metals, and endocrine-disrupting chemicals, can impair fertility. These toxins can interfere with hormonal balance and damage reproductive organs, leading to infertility.
Tubal Factor Infertility
Tubal factor infertility accounts for approximately 25-30% of female infertility cases. This condition occurs when the fallopian tubes are blocked or damaged, preventing the sperm from reaching the egg or the fertilized egg from reaching the uterus.
Causes of Tubal Factor Infertility
Pelvic Inflammatory Disease (PID): PID is an infection of the female reproductive organs, often caused by sexually transmitted infections (STIs). It can lead to scarring and blockage of the fallopian tubes.
Endometriosis: This condition occurs when the tissue that usually lines the uterus grows outside of it, causing inflammation and scarring that can obstruct the fallopian tubes.
Surgery: Previous surgeries involving the fallopian tubes, such as tubal ligation or surgery for ectopic pregnancy, can result in tubal damage or blockage.

Ovulation disorders are among the most common causes of female infertility. These disorders can result from hormonal imbalances, medical conditions, or lifestyle factors.
Anovulation
Anovulation refers to the absence of ovulation, where the ovaries do not release an egg during the menstrual cycle. This condition can be caused by PCOS, thyroid dysfunction, or excessive exercise.
Oligoovulation
Oligoovulation is characterized by infrequent or irregular ovulation. Women with this condition may have difficulty predicting their fertile window, making it challenging to conceive.
Premature Ovarian Insufficiency (POI)
POI, also known as premature menopause, occurs when the ovaries stop functioning normally before the age of 40. This condition can lead to irregular menstrual cycles and reduced fertility.
Structural Causes of Female Infertility
Structural abnormalities in the reproductive organs can hinder conception and lead to infertility. These abnormalities can be congenital or acquired.
Uterine Fibroids
Uterine fibroids are non-cancerous growths that develop in the uterus. Depending on their size and location, fibroids can interfere with implantation or block the fallopian tubes, causing infertility.
Uterine Polyps
Polyps are benign growths that develop on the lining of the uterus. They can cause irregular menstrual bleeding and may interfere with implantation, leading to infertility.
Congenital Abnormalities
Congenital abnormalities, such as a septate uterus or bicornuate uterus, can affect the shape and function of the uterus. These abnormalities can hinder implantation and increase the risk of miscarriage.
Medical Causes of Female Infertility
Certain medical conditions can contribute to female infertility by affecting hormonal balance, ovulation, or the reproductive organs.
Diabetes
Uncontrolled diabetes can lead to hormonal imbalances and irregular menstrual cycles, making it difficult for women to conceive.
Autoimmune Disorders
Autoimmune disorders, such as lupus or rheumatoid arthritis, can affect fertility by causing inflammation and damage to reproductive organs.
Cancer and Cancer Treatments
Cancer and its treatments, such as chemotherapy and radiation, can impair fertility by damaging the ovaries or other reproductive organs.
